[問題] 求救excel 下拉選單複選 100p

看板Office作者 (吼吼)時間5年前 (2019/02/08 03:48), 編輯推噓0(0097)
留言97則, 2人參與, 5年前最新討論串1/1
試了好幾天,終於想到上ptt 求救 懇請各位大大幫忙 手機拍攝螢幕請見諒qwq https://i.imgur.com/hikB4ox.jpg
正常來說應該如上圖 下拉選單複選會跳出系統讓我選擇選項 但不知道為何,我的電腦偏偏不行 如下圖 https://i.imgur.com/biBTxF9.jpg
變成只能單選 我試過我妹,朋友的都可以 但我的怎樣都只能單選,無法跳出系統那個介面 重灌,安裝office 和他們一樣版本都不行 巨集都已開啟一樣無法 懇請板上高手幫忙 若有需要可以email 此檔案協助 因為真的很困擾,若能解決願奉上100p答謝 拜託大家了,謝謝!! -- ※ 發信站: 批踢踢實業坊(ptt.cc), 來自: 223.140.198.114 ※ 文章網址: https://www.ptt.cc/bbs/Office/M.1549568933.A.3AD.html

02/08 09:02, 5年前 , 1F
02/08 09:02, 1F

02/08 09:04, 5年前 , 2F
設計上可於vbe內插入自訂表單設計
02/08 09:04, 2F

02/08 09:06, 5年前 , 3F
回文上有用到標籤、核取方塊、框架和命令按鈕
02/08 09:06, 3F

02/08 09:11, 5年前 , 4F
如選取儲存格就顯示該表單的話,可以worksheet_
02/08 09:11, 4F

02/08 09:11, 5年前 , 5F
selectionchange觸發事件,顯示上以表單名稱.show方式;限
02/08 09:11, 5F

02/08 09:11, 5年前 , 6F
縮觸發事件儲存格的話,range.column和range.row或
02/08 09:11, 6F

02/08 09:11, 5年前 , 7F
intersect
02/08 09:11, 7F

02/08 12:28, 5年前 , 8F
我單純無法跳出系統那個介面,導致無法複選,請問要
02/08 12:28, 8F

02/08 12:28, 5年前 , 9F
按什麼指令才會跳出那個介面呢,謝謝
02/08 12:28, 9F

02/08 12:29, 5年前 , 10F
因為這是別人的表單,vba ...都用密碼鎖住,我是無
02/08 12:29, 10F

02/08 12:29, 5年前 , 11F
法修改的
02/08 12:29, 11F

02/08 12:36, 5年前 , 12F
這從檔案來判斷會比較確定,要不丟上雲端空間貼上連結
02/08 12:36, 12F

02/08 12:40, 5年前 , 13F
不然先看開發人員→程式碼→巨集,如果呼叫該自訂表單是以
02/08 12:40, 13F

02/08 12:42, 5年前 , 14F
程序且不傳值(址)的話,應可看到
02/08 12:42, 14F

02/08 13:33, 5年前 , 15F

02/08 13:33, 5年前 , 16F
F4Ry1ZYWJ2YzctVXM5Y0JvSXMzaHFselo4/view?usp=dri
02/08 13:33, 16F

02/08 13:33, 5年前 , 17F
vesdk
02/08 13:33, 17F

02/08 13:34, 5年前 , 18F
我已傳上雲端共用,還請幫忙看一下,謝謝
02/08 13:34, 18F

02/08 13:50, 5年前 , 19F
測試af欄可以開啟該自訂表單,巨集的安全性有調整為啟用嗎
02/08 13:50, 19F

02/08 13:50, 5年前 , 20F
02/08 13:50, 20F

02/08 13:51, 5年前 , 21F
啟用後關掉excel程式,重新開啟再開該檔也是一樣嗎?
02/08 13:51, 21F

02/08 14:10, 5年前 , 22F
沒錯,試過巨集安全性啟用,重開還是不行
02/08 14:10, 22F

02/08 14:16, 5年前 , 23F
那先做個測試 http://tinyurl.com/ybfu7yna 這個檔案下載
02/08 14:16, 23F

02/08 14:17, 5年前 , 24F
執行,因有在worksheet_selectionchange內寫了觸發事件
02/08 14:17, 24F

02/08 14:17, 5年前 , 25F
原po執行後,任選一個儲存格應會彈出個訊息顯示所選的儲存
02/08 14:17, 25F

02/08 14:18, 5年前 , 26F
格位置才是
02/08 14:18, 26F

02/08 15:28, 5年前 , 27F
有的,我下載您的測試檔,任選一個是能跳出該行列的
02/08 15:28, 27F

02/08 15:28, 5年前 , 28F
位置訊息
02/08 15:28, 28F

02/08 15:28, 5年前 , 29F

02/08 15:42, 5年前 , 30F
那應表示原po目前用的excel安全性是可以觸發該事件的
02/08 15:42, 30F

02/08 15:42, 5年前 , 31F
原檔案有寫on error resume next
02/08 15:42, 31F

02/08 15:44, 5年前 , 32F
這個部分有二處,我先註解'不執行
02/08 15:44, 32F

02/08 15:44, 5年前 , 33F

02/08 15:45, 5年前 , 34F
下載,選取會觸發事件的欄位,如ac、af欄看是否會有錯誤訊
02/08 15:45, 34F

02/08 15:45, 5年前 , 35F
02/08 15:45, 35F

02/08 16:36, 5年前 , 36F
您好,ac, af 並未跳出錯誤訊息,但還是只能單選
02/08 16:36, 36F

02/08 16:37, 5年前 , 37F

02/08 17:36, 5年前 , 38F
02/08 17:36, 38F

02/08 17:38, 5年前 , 39F
先將是否有下拉清單或是第一列為多選、複選條件判斷註解起
02/08 17:38, 39F

02/08 17:39, 5年前 , 40F
來,所以ac:am欄都可以試試,看是否會出現
02/08 17:39, 40F

02/08 20:47, 5年前 , 41F
有了,出現了!!!痛哭流涕 QwQ
02/08 20:47, 41F

02/08 20:47, 5年前 , 42F
太感謝了,請問是為何會這樣,謝謝
02/08 20:47, 42F

02/08 20:49, 5年前 , 43F

02/08 20:49, 5年前 , 44F
只是有些字好像會被吃掉lol
02/08 20:49, 44F

02/08 20:50, 5年前 , 45F
不過大致上不影響,為何會有這樣情形出現,然後因為
02/08 20:50, 45F

02/08 20:50, 5年前 , 46F
我只是部分資料,這樣和其他人合併時會有錯誤嗎,真
02/08 20:50, 46F

02/08 20:50, 5年前 , 47F
的真的非常謝謝您的幫忙!!
02/08 20:50, 47F

02/08 20:55, 5年前 , 48F
剛剛稍微看了一下,跳出來核取方塊並非寫系統而是亂
02/08 20:55, 48F

02/08 20:55, 5年前 , 49F
碼,這樣會影響到什麼嗎? 如果沒差就不用在意,因
02/08 20:55, 49F

02/08 20:55, 5年前 , 50F
為有點怕到了,謝謝;)
02/08 20:55, 50F

02/08 21:21, 5年前 , 51F
有可能會也有可能不會影響,要看實際情況了
02/08 21:21, 51F

02/08 21:21, 5年前 , 52F
另外,改以其他格式 http://tinyurl.com/y7lookfz
02/08 21:21, 52F

02/08 21:21, 5年前 , 53F
原po試試這個版本是否會正常
02/08 21:21, 53F

02/08 22:53, 5年前 , 54F
沒辦法QAQ, V4 和原本一樣無法複選https://i.imgur
02/08 22:53, 54F

02/08 22:53, 5年前 , 55F
.com/vA8GOQC.jpg
02/08 22:53, 55F

02/08 22:54, 5年前 , 56F

02/08 22:56, 5年前 , 57F
那看來就以回文17:36的那個版本來做為輸入資料的檔案了
02/08 22:56, 57F

02/08 22:56, 5年前 , 58F
發現一個神秘的小地方,和成功的V2 相比,V4 檔案多
02/08 22:56, 58F

02/08 22:56, 5年前 , 59F
了個驚嘆號
02/08 22:56, 59F

02/08 22:57, 5年前 , 60F

02/08 22:58, 5年前 , 61F
想請問是這個檔案本身問題還是我的電腦問題呢?
02/08 22:58, 61F

02/08 22:59, 5年前 , 62F
副檔名不同,有驚嘆號為xlsm,另一個為xlsb
02/08 22:59, 62F

02/08 23:00, 5年前 , 63F
然後最重要的一個問題是,以17:36作為輸入資料後,
02/08 23:00, 63F

02/08 23:00, 5年前 , 64F
我最後完成以後和其他人的檔案合併會發生問題嗎?
02/08 23:00, 64F

02/08 23:00, 5年前 , 65F
因為這是個研究,怕我的資料最後會無法跑這樣就功虧
02/08 23:00, 65F

02/08 23:00, 5年前 , 66F
一簣了,抱歉問題有點多,但真的真的很感謝您的幫忙
02/08 23:00, 66F

02/08 23:00, 5年前 , 67F
,謝謝!
02/08 23:00, 67F

02/08 23:03, 5年前 , 68F
可以試幾筆,存檔,再開啟看看
02/08 23:03, 68F

02/08 23:08, 5年前 , 69F
好的,能冒昧請教問題大致出在什麼地方嗎(雖然可能
02/08 23:08, 69F

02/08 23:08, 5年前 , 70F
聽不懂lol
02/08 23:08, 70F

02/08 23:14, 5年前 , 71F
因視窗左上角非寫系統而是亂碼的關係,是否在其他地方也會
02/08 23:14, 71F

02/08 23:14, 5年前 , 72F
有這種情況,而導致資料不正確方面可以測試一下
02/08 23:14, 72F

02/08 23:15, 5年前 , 73F
至於有些字好像會被吃掉方面,測試一下原po的原始檔案
02/08 23:15, 73F

02/08 23:15, 5年前 , 74F
這方面是一樣的 https://i.imgur.com/DLoMklM.jpg
02/08 23:15, 74F

02/08 23:55, 5年前 , 75F
真的很謝謝soyoso 大大的鼎力相助,原本想給稅後10
02/08 23:55, 75F

02/08 23:55, 5年前 , 76F
0p 但小弟總共只有106p ,通通都轉給大大了,祝大大
02/08 23:55, 76F

02/08 23:55, 5年前 , 77F
新年快樂,一切順心:)
02/08 23:55, 77F

02/08 23:56, 5年前 , 78F
p.s 如果方便的話小弟還是想知道一下這個問題大致是
02/08 23:56, 78F

02/08 23:56, 5年前 , 79F
出在哪,謝謝您
02/08 23:56, 79F

02/09 14:04, 5年前 , 80F
這個問題我測試於win版的2007(12.0.6425.1000)開啟,出現
02/09 14:04, 80F

02/09 14:04, 5年前 , 81F
如n,o,u,af...等無法出現清單功能,所以無自訂表單,其他
02/09 14:04, 81F

02/09 14:04, 5年前 , 82F
如果出現清單功能,如m,q,ac...等則有顯示自訂表單,所以
02/09 14:04, 82F

02/09 14:04, 5年前 , 83F
這和原po情況不同。其他如
02/09 14:04, 83F

02/09 14:04, 5年前 , 84F
32位元版:2010(14.0.6023.1000)、2016(16.0.4513.1000)的
02/09 14:04, 84F

02/09 14:04, 5年前 , 85F
64位元版:2016(16.0.4266.1001)、2019(16.0.11126.20192)
02/09 14:04, 85F

02/09 14:04, 5年前 , 86F
02/09 14:04, 86F

02/09 14:04, 5年前 , 87F
mac版的2019(16.20(181208))測試上皆可正常顯示。
02/09 14:04, 87F

02/09 14:04, 5年前 , 88F
所以這方面可以要看原po是用什麼版本才能看看是否是這方面
02/09 14:04, 88F

02/09 14:04, 5年前 , 89F
的問題了
02/09 14:04, 89F

02/10 10:31, 5年前 , 90F
我用64 2016,64 office 365皆打不開
02/10 10:31, 90F

02/10 10:32, 5年前 , 91F
和VBA 版本會有關係嗎
02/10 10:32, 91F

02/10 10:49, 5年前 , 92F
2016的64位元版本也有測試是可以執行的,至於vba版本方面
02/10 10:49, 92F

02/10 10:49, 5年前 , 93F
也是要看原po是什麼版本,再以那個版本測試才會知道是否有
02/10 10:49, 93F

02/10 10:49, 5年前 , 94F
關係了
02/10 10:49, 94F

02/10 11:01, 5年前 , 95F
這是測試於2016的64位元,版本如回文
02/10 11:01, 95F

02/10 11:01, 5年前 , 96F

02/10 11:03, 5年前 , 97F
vba版本為7.1.1048
02/10 11:03, 97F
文章代碼(AID): #1SN8kbEj (Office)
文章代碼(AID): #1SN8kbEj (Office)